Microbiome Therapy Protects Against Recurrent Bacterial Vaginosis

Friday, May 15, 2020 - 11:40 in Health & Medicine

A product containing healthy vaginal bacteria has proved effective against recurrent bacterial vaginosis (BV), an extremely common vaginal infection that is associated with preterm birth, HIV infection and problems with in vitro fertilization. Bacterial vaginosis is one of the most frequent bacterial infections, affecting nearly 30 percent of women of reproductive age in the United States, and […]
